          Pros and Cons
          • Easy to use with quick installation and user-friendly interface.

          • Provides excellent performance and scalability for relational database management.

          • Supports spatial data and functions, enhancing geographical calculations.

          • Open source nature with industry-level security and community support.

          • Efficient for both beginners and experienced professionals, aiding in fast project completion.

          • Limited support for marketplace apps and connectors, restricting advanced functionalities.

          • Richness of features and customizations can be complex without proper support.

          • Simplifies data management from multiple sources, making it efficient and easy for users to transform data for analysis.

          • Provides excellent customer support, quick issue resolution, and custom connector creation.

          • Ease of use and quick setup, reducing the need for manual data handling and engineering efforts.

          • Automates data pipeline setup, accelerating the process of gaining insights.

          • Democratizes data access, enabling various stakeholders to analyze data regardless of technical expertise.

          • May lack some enterprise features like 2FA and complex connectivity options for larger businesses.

          • The user interface and dashboard could be improved for better usability.

          • May face limitations in handling extremely large datasets or advanced ETL job flows.

          Some top alternatives to MySQL includes Microsoft SQL Server, MongoDB, Oracle Database, Oracle SQL Developer, OrientDB, Microsoft Access, CrateDB, MariaDB and RediSQL.

          Some top alternatives to Panoply includes Talend Cloud Data Integration, Etlworks Integrator, Stitch, Matillion ETL, Fivetran, Blendo, Xplenty, Etleap, ETLrobot and Portal.
